Searched refs:VariableMap (Results 1 – 6 of 6) sorted by relevance
/external/swiftshader/third_party/llvm-16.0/llvm/lib/CodeGen/ |
D | RemoveRedundantDebugValues.cpp | 87 VariableMap; in reduceDbgValsForwardScan() local 94 auto VMI = VariableMap.find(Var); in reduceDbgValsForwardScan() 101 if (MI.isDebugValueList() && VMI != VariableMap.end()) { in reduceDbgValsForwardScan() 102 VariableMap.erase(VMI); in reduceDbgValsForwardScan() 109 if (VMI != VariableMap.end()) in reduceDbgValsForwardScan() 110 VariableMap.erase(VMI); in reduceDbgValsForwardScan() 115 if (VMI == VariableMap.end() || in reduceDbgValsForwardScan() 118 VariableMap[Var] = {&Loc, MI.getDebugExpression()}; in reduceDbgValsForwardScan() 131 for (auto &Var : VariableMap) { in reduceDbgValsForwardScan() 134 VariableMap.erase(Var.first); in reduceDbgValsForwardScan()
|
D | AssignmentTrackingAnalysis.cpp | 2207 DenseMap<DebugVariable, std::pair<Value *, DIExpression *>> VariableMap; in removeRedundantDbgLocsUsingForwardScan() local 2228 auto VMI = VariableMap.find(Key); in removeRedundantDbgLocsUsingForwardScan() 2232 if (VMI == VariableMap.end() || VMI->second.first != Loc.V || in removeRedundantDbgLocsUsingForwardScan() 2234 VariableMap[Key] = {Loc.V, Loc.Expr}; in removeRedundantDbgLocsUsingForwardScan() 2289 DenseMap<DebugVariable, std::pair<Value *, DIExpression *>> VariableMap; in removeUndefDbgLocsFromEntryBlock() local
|
/external/swiftshader/third_party/subzero/src/ |
D | IceVariableSplitting.cpp | 49 class VariableMap { class 51 VariableMap() = delete; 52 VariableMap(const VariableMap &) = delete; 53 VariableMap &operator=(const VariableMap &) = delete; 73 explicit VariableMap(Cfg *Func) in VariableMap() function in Ice::__anon6e0a37a90111::VariableMap 432 VariableMap VarMap;
|
/external/llvm/utils/TableGen/ |
D | DAGISelMatcherGen.cpp | 60 StringMap<unsigned> VariableMap; member in __anoncde0d5ea0111::MatcherGen 123 unsigned VarMapEntry = VariableMap[Name]; in getNamedArgumentSlot() 274 unsigned InputOperand = VariableMap[N->getName()] - 1; in EmitLeafMatchCode() 442 unsigned &VarMapEntry = VariableMap[Name]; in recordUniqueNode()
|
/external/swiftshader/third_party/llvm-10.0/llvm/lib/Transforms/Utils/ |
D | BasicBlockUtils.cpp | 387 DenseMap<DebugVariable, std::pair<Value *, DIExpression *> > VariableMap; in removeRedundantDbgInstrsUsingForwardScan() local 393 auto VMI = VariableMap.find(Key); in removeRedundantDbgInstrsUsingForwardScan() 396 if (VMI == VariableMap.end() || in removeRedundantDbgInstrsUsingForwardScan() 399 VariableMap[Key] = { DVI->getValue(), DVI->getExpression() }; in removeRedundantDbgInstrsUsingForwardScan()
|
/external/swiftshader/third_party/llvm-16.0/llvm/lib/Transforms/Utils/ |
D | BasicBlockUtils.cpp | 445 VariableMap; in removeRedundantDbgInstrsUsingForwardScan() local 450 auto VMI = VariableMap.find(Key); in removeRedundantDbgInstrsUsingForwardScan() 459 if (VMI == VariableMap.end() || VMI->second.first != Values || in removeRedundantDbgInstrsUsingForwardScan() 465 VariableMap[Key] = {Values, DVI->getExpression()}; in removeRedundantDbgInstrsUsingForwardScan() 467 VariableMap[Key] = {Values, nullptr}; in removeRedundantDbgInstrsUsingForwardScan()
|